CESTOS City, River Cess – Citizens of Rivercess County have lauded Senator Bill Twehway for what they describe as his pivotal role in transforming the county’s educational outcomes, following the official release of the 2025 WASSCE results.
According to the West African Examinations Council (WAEC), all 125 candidates who sat the exams from Rivercess successfully passed, giving the county the highest percentage pass rate in Liberia.
The remarkable performance comes after a series of interventions by Senator Twehway aimed at improving student preparedness. These included cash donations to schools, providing past exam question booklets, and personally engaging students in extra classes where he taught and motivated candidates.
Citizens say these initiatives have restored confidence in the county’s educational system and set a new benchmark for academic excellence nationwide.
